Kiki Jamieson Jeopardy Contestant Profile

Kiki Jamieson is a notable figure in the philanthropic sector with a robust background in academia and nonprofit leadership. Originally from the United States, Jamieson holds dual citizenship with Canada, where she currently resides in Toronto, Ontario. She is actively involved in nonprofit consulting, focusing on strategic planning, leadership, and policy advocacy for various organizations. Jamieson’s career is highlighted by her tenure as the President of The Fund for New Jersey, where she led initiatives to support progressive public policies, racial justice, and multiracial democracy.

Educationally, Jamieson is well-versed, having earned her Ph.D. in Political Science from Rutgers University, where her dissertation received accolades. She also holds an A.B. degree from Bryn Mawr College. Her academic journey includes teaching positions at prestigious institutions such as Princeton University, the University of Pennsylvania, Haverford College, and Rutgers University. Notably, she has been a visiting scholar at the Institute for Advanced Study and has authored influential works, including “Real Choices: Feminism, Freedom, and the Limits of Law.”

Throughout her career, Jamieson has developed and led numerous programs aimed at fostering community engagement, social justice, and effective public policy. Her efforts include directing the Pace Center for Civic Engagement and engaging in philanthropic leadership through various fellowships and board memberships, including her role as a trustee at Bryn Mawr College. Jamieson’s work consistently emphasizes inclusivity, diversity, and the advancement of equity in public discourse and policy implementation.
